Special Topic Introduction
Extracellular vesicle (EV) research is rapidly advancing our understanding of intercellular communication and driving the development of innovative diagnostic and therapeutic approaches. As the field continues to expand, communication, collaboration and the integration of multidisciplinary expertise are essential to accelerate the translation of fundamental discoveries into clinical and technical applications.
The 8th International GEIVEX Symposium, to be held in Bilbao, Spain, from 6–9 October 2026, will bring together researchers, clinicians, early-career scientists, and industry partners to discuss the latest developments in EV research. Since its establishment in 2012, the Spanish Group for Extracellular Vesicles (GEIVEX) has become an international reference for promoting scientific excellence, collaboration, and knowledge exchange within the EV community.
The symposium will feature a comprehensive scientific programme spanning key areas of contemporary EV research, including therapeutic applications; innovations in EV methodologies; emerging insights into EV biology in neural biology and neurodegeneration; the impact of EVs on cancer evolution; and the role of EVs in cross-kingdom communication and infectious diseases. An Educational Day preceding the meeting will provide practical sessions on state-of-the-art technologies for EV isolation, characterization, and functional analysis, fostering training and interaction among participants.
This Special Issue is launched in conjunction with the symposium to showcase cutting-edge advances presented during the meeting and to provide a platform for disseminating high-quality research emerging from the Spanish EV community. We warmly invite symposium participants and contributors to submit original research articles, reviews, and perspectives that reflect the breadth, innovation, and translational potential of extracellular vesicle research. Together, the symposium and this Special Issue aim to strengthen scientific collaboration and advance the development of EV-based technologies for precision medicine and global health.
